1. Airthings Wave Plus 2026 Edition – Best Overall for Health-Conscious Homes

The Airthings Wave Plus has long been a benchmark for indoor air quality monitoring, and the 2026 Edition refines the formula with upgraded VOC sensing and a sleeker design. This unit measures radon, PM2.5, CO2, humidity, temperature, and total VOCs—all in a compact, battery-powered device that mounts on a wall or sits on a shelf. What sets it apart is its proactive alert system: if CO2 spikes above 1,200 ppm or radon exceeds EPA action levels, the Wave Plus sends a push notification to your phone. During my month-long test in a 1,200-square-foot apartment, the device accurately tracked a 40% humidity drop after I turned on the heat, prompting me to run a humidifier. The accompanying app is intuitive, providing daily scores and long-term trends. At $249.99, it’s a premium investment, but the radon detection alone justifies the price for homeowners in radon-prone areas. Battery life is rated at two years, though I’d recommend swapping batteries every 18 months for consistent accuracy.

Pros: Radon monitoring, long battery life, accurate CO2 sensing
Cons: No Wi-Fi (uses Bluetooth), slightly bulky design
Best for: Families concerned about radon and overall IAQ

2. uHoo Smart Air 3 – Best for Allergy and Asthma Sufferers

If you’re tired of guessing why your allergies flare up indoors, the uHoo Smart Air 3 is your detective. This sensor-packed unit tracks nine parameters: PM1.0, PM2.5, PM10, CO2, CO, TVOCs, temperature, humidity, and air pressure. Its standout feature is real-time particle analysis, which can distinguish between dust, pollen, and smoke. During wildfire season, I placed the uHoo near a window and watched PM2.5 levels jump from 12 µg/m³ to 58 µg/m³ within an hour—a clear signal to close the window and turn on an air purifier. The device connects via Wi-Fi and integrates seamlessly with Alexa, Google Home, and IFTTT. You can set automations like “If PM2.5 exceeds 35 µg/m³, turn on the Levoit air purifier.” At $299.99, it’s pricier than the Airthings, but the granular particle data and automation capabilities make it a power user’s dream. The only downside is the cable—it’s AC-powered, so placement is limited to near outlets.

Pros: Nine sensors, particle differentiation, strong smart home integration
Cons: Corded, higher price point
Best for: Allergy sufferers and smart home enthusiasts

3. Temtop M10i – Best Budget Option for Basic Monitoring

Not everyone needs radon detection or nine sensors. For renters, students, or those on a budget, the Temtop M10i delivers reliable PM2.5 and CO2 monitoring at a fraction of the cost—$89.99. This portable device features a color-coded LED display (green, yellow, red) that gives instant feedback, plus a rechargeable battery that lasts up to 8 hours. I tested it in a home office and found the CO2 readings closely matched the uHoo’s, with a variance of only 15 ppm. The Temtop also includes a histogram feature that shows trends over the past 24 hours, which is handy for identifying patterns. The lack of Wi-Fi means no app or alerts, but the onboard memory stores up to 10 days of data. For the price, it’s a no-brainer for anyone who wants to dip their toes into air quality monitoring without a major investment.

Pros: Affordable, portable, accurate basic sensors
Cons: No Wi-Fi or smart home integration, limited parameters
Best for: Budget-conscious users and temporary setups

Sensor Accuracy: Look for devices that use electrochemical or optical sensors rather than cheaper metal-oxide sensors, which can drift over time. The uHoo and Airthings both use industrial-grade components.

Real-Time vs. Historical Data: If you want to track trends, opt for a Wi-Fi-enabled unit that syncs to the cloud. The Temtop’s onboard memory is adequate for short-term analysis.

Alerts and Automations: For allergy sufferers, push alerts for PM spikes are invaluable. The uHoo’s IFTTT integration allows for automations like turning on a fan when CO2 rises.

Buying Guide

Who Should Buy a Smart Air Quality Monitor?

  • Homeowners with basements: Radon is a silent killer, and the Airthings Wave Plus is the only consumer monitor that detects it reliably.
  • Remote workers: High CO2 levels reduce cognitive function. A monitor like the uHoo or Temtop can remind you to ventilate your home office.
  • Families with asthma or allergies: Particle detection is critical. The uHoo’s ability to distinguish pollen from dust helps you target interventions.
  • Tech enthusiasts: If you have a smart home ecosystem, the uHoo’s integrations are unmatched.

Installation & Smart Home Integration

Installation is straightforward for all three units. The Airthings mounts with adhesive strips or screws (included) and pairs via Bluetooth. The uHoo requires a wall outlet and Wi-Fi setup through its app (takes about 5 minutes). The Temtop is ready out of the box—just charge and place.

For smart home integration, the uHoo is the clear winner. I set up a routine in Google Home: “If uHoo detects PM2.5 above 50, turn on the air purifier and send a notification.” The Airthings lacks Wi-Fi but works with the Airthings Wave app for iOS and Android. The Temtop has no smart features, but its simplicity is a plus for non-tech users.
